20 May ATIA secures airline panel for BBOTR Brisbane to give travel industry crucial aviation updates May 20, 2026 By Amanda Rixon Media Release 0 : ATIA’s Beyond Borders on the Road (BBOTR) series continues in Brisbane tonight (May 20), bringing the travel industry together for an evening of networking, industry insights and updates from across the sector. Following the success of the Sydney event last month, BBOTR Brisbane will see the return of sessions: Updates from the ATIA leadership team, including advocacy and compliance insights. Update on RBA surcharging changes from major sponsor TravelPay. From influence to impact: how to stand out as a travel expert with Nicole O’Sullivan. Plus, there will be industry insights from exclusive sessions including: Go Insurance, major sponsor for BBOTR Brisbane, will delve into the importance of travel insurance and explain their new War & Armed Conflict Disruption cover extension. Aviation panel discussion moderated by Brisbane Airport, with panellists from Cathay Pacific and CVFR Consolidation Services. Henry Tuttiett, Executive General Manager Communications & Public Affairs at Brisbane Airport will moderate the panel alongside panellists Tom Kennedy, Regional Head of Sales – Distribution Partnerships, Southeast Asia & Oceania from Cathay Pacific and James Brooker, General Manager AU/NZ, CVFR Consolidation Services. The aviation panellists will bring their unique insights into key current topics, including Middle East flight plans and the collaborative steps they have taken to minimise the impact on travellers and their travel agency and tour operator partners. With content tailored to the issues affecting travel businesses the most, the panel will allow ATIA members to hear directly from representatives of the aviation industry. QUOTES ATTRIBUTABLE TO ATIA CEO, DEAN LONG: “Flight disruptions are a major concern for travel businesses and travellers at the moment, and ATIA is glad to be bringing some of the leading voices in aviation to BBOTR Brisbane.
